Outdoor Adventure in Mole Creek, Tasmania

Located in Tasmania’s Central Highlands, Mole Creek is a top destination for outdoor lovers seeking cave exploration and wilderness hiking. Known for its spectacular karst landscapes, Mole Creek offers unique adventures underground and among ancient forests.

Overland Track

Hiking the Overland Track in Tasmania's Wilderness

Explore the 65 km Overland Track in Tasmania’s Cradle Mountain-Lake St Clair National Park. A challenging multi-day hike through alpine peaks, rainforests, and moorlands. Encounter unique wildlife, stunning glacial lakes, and rugged landscapes for a rewarding wilderness adventure.

Cradle Mountain

Cradle Mountain: Tasmania's Rugged Masterpiece

Explore the rugged beauty of Cradle Mountain in Tasmania. Known for its jagged peaks and reflective lakes, this area offers hiking trails ranging from easy lake loops to challenging summit ascents. A must-visit for adventure seekers, it's accessible year-round but weather can be unpredictable.

Essential Travel Tips

1

Book cave tours in advance, especially in peak seasons.

2

Wear sturdy footwear and bring warm clothing for cave exploration.

3

Mobile reception is limited; download maps and guides before arrival.

4

Respect protected areas and follow park guidelines.

5

Check weather forecasts, as conditions can change quickly in the region.

6

Driving is the primary way to reach hiking and caving sites.
